The Ajax load is a simple method to connect the server, other data files, and web page. Or if you have favorited it before, just click the library name in the Favorites section. if(typeof ez_ad_units!='undefined'){ez_ad_units.push([[300,250],'yogihosting_com-large-leaderboard-2','ezslot_4',187,'0','0'])};__ez_fad_position('div-gpt-ad-yogihosting_com-large-leaderboard-2-0');Do you have any question? Making statements based on opinion; back them up with references or personal experience. The function specified by the ajaxError() function is called when the request fails or generates the errors. One of the best features of jQuery AJAX Method is to load data from external website by calling APIs, and get the response in JSON or XML formats. WebMethod-2 Using jQuery.each function bind data in the table Using jQuery to build table rows from AJAX response. Strange horizontal space when using babel's \foreignlanguage in a LLNCS document, Removing part of the polygon outside of another shapefile but keeping the parts that overlap. To jQuery, Ajax load needs to either download the jQuery library or use the jQuery CDN version link. Heres what its like to develop VR at Meta (Ep. Scroll to the top of the page using JavaScript? http://jsfiddle.net/6AcAr/ - with timeout(only for demo) C# Programming, Conditional Constructs, Loops, Arrays, OOPS Concept, This website or its third-party tools use cookies, which are necessary to its functioning and required to achieve the purposes illustrated in the cookie policy. Can a 14 AWG pigtail be used with a smart switch with a 20 amp breaker? In this example I will show you how easy it is to make such API calls in jQuery AJAX. Simple Utility Function This will allow you to call a utility function that accepts the element you're looking for and if you want the element to be fully in view or but I do believe that this is the cleanest and most effective solution, and it doesn't require you to load jQuery! WebSelectors. I want to work with promises but I have a callback API in a format like: 1. Or there is some event for it? Im populating some dropdowns with XMLHTTP, while this is loading I would like show the load screen. Invokes the specified function exactly once, passing in this selection along with any optional arguments. If document.addEventListener doesn't exist, then install event handlers using .attachEvent() for "onreadystatechange" and "onload" events. The jQuery.ajax() method no longer strips off the hash in the URL if it is provided, and sends the full URL to the transport (xhr, script, jsonp, or custom transport). you wont see any loading gif if your page is loaded fast, so use this code on a page with high loading time, and i also recommend to put your js on the bottom of the page. WebCall the progressCallbacks on a Deferred object with the given context and args. The jQueryajax load is handling data of the other servers or data files. $( selector, [context], [root] ) selector searches within the context scope which searches within the root scope.selector and context can be a string expression, DOM Element, array of DOM elements, or cheerio object.root is typically the HTML document string. WebSo when the h3 or p or span element content is clicked, the click event gets generated, and the respective element contents, elements font style gets changed as applied by the handler function. You must use the full jQuery instead. For example, the function you want to load when document or page load is called "yourFunction". This URL sends a request to the HTTP server. This API provides the response in JSON format. JQuery files placing inside of the jQueryLoad.html file in the body section. Thanks for contributing an answer to Stack Overflow! jQuery(document).ready(function($){ // standard on load code goes here with $ prefix // note: the $ is setup inside the anonymous function of the ready command }); The consent submitted will only be used for data processing originating from this website. To know more kindly check this tutorial , New York, San Francisco, London, Mumbai & Santa Lucia, Implementing TheMovieDB (TMDB) API with jQuery AJAX, How to Upload Multiple files using jQuery AJAX in ASP.NET MVC, jQuery Post Complete Guide for Beginners and Experts Examples & Codes, jQuery AJAX Events Complete Guide for Beginners and Experts, jQuery Get Complete Guide for Beginners and Experts, Learn ASP.NET Core with Tutorials for Beginners to Advanced Coders. Note On the button click event I first did some validation by telling the user to select a city before they press the button. The Ajax load syntax is using three terminologies to load, access, and return data. version added: 1.0 jQuery.getJSON( url [, data ] [, success ] ) url. Then use this KEY to make API calls with jQuery AJAX.if(typeof ez_ad_units!='undefined'){ez_ad_units.push([[300,250],'yogihosting_com-medrectangle-4','ezslot_1',183,'0','0'])};__ez_fad_position('div-gpt-ad-yogihosting_com-medrectangle-4-0'); In my application there is a HTML Select control and a button. The Ajax load is a method to send a request to the server using HTTP to load the data and shows data into the output screen. If you would like to change your settings or withdraw consent at any time, the link to do so is in our privacy policy accessible from our home page. Xian's answer can be extended with a more specific selector, using the following line of code: This method only allows 0-9 both keyboard and numpad, backspaces, tab, left and right arrows (normal form operations) The selector is referring to as ID, class, tag, or attributes. jquery3jqueryjquery ++Unicode+call : base64 jQuery 3.0 ready() Changes. And if page time is large, it looks broken and defeats the purpose. The basic Ajax load with ID syntax is below. Assuming that the question is How do I check a checkbox-set BY VALUE?. HTML, CSS, JS are all good as given in above answers. WebDescription: Load JSON-encoded data from the server using a GET HTTP request. The #ID is selecting the selector and displays only part of the selectors data. $('input').on('change', function() { // Does some stuff and logs the event to the console }); WebThe jQuery ajax() function is a built-in function in jQuery. This web links all data load on the server. If you need to use another JavaScript library alongside jQuery, return control of $ back to the other library with a call to $.noConflict(). This works great for me. Try the code below: WebRsidence officielle des rois de France, le chteau de Versailles et ses jardins comptent parmi les plus illustres monuments du patrimoine mondial et constituent la plus complte ralisation de lart franais du XVIIe sicle. When data is an object, jQuery generates the data string from the object's key/value pairs unless the processData option is set to false.For example, { a: "bc", d: "e,f" } is converted to the string "a=bc&d=e%2Cf".If the value is an UPDATE Here is a link how google does it Source. All jQuery AJAX methods use the ajax() method. Welcome to YogiHosting - A Programming Tutorial Website. Could a society ever exist that considers indiscriminate killing socially acceptable? Manage Settings The jQuery ajax load is a procedure to load information to the server and shows data. Find centralized, trusted content and collaborate around the technologies you use most. This is a really great jumpstart, but I think you're missing something that features in @3nigma's answer. This syntax returns only part of the data in using the selector. By closing this banner, scrolling this page, clicking a link or continuing to browse otherwise, you agree to our Privacy Policy, Explore 1000+ varieties of Mock tests View more, 600+ Online Courses | 50+ projects | 3000+ Hours | Verifiable Certificates | Lifetime Access, Software Development Course - All in One Bundle. Should I compensate for lost water when working with frozen rhubarb? OpenWeatherMap API. When the page full loads then i want to replace the loading icon with the html elements(contents of page). This is equivalent to invoking the function by hand but facilitates method chaining. . http://jsfiddle.net/47PkH/ - no timeout(use this for actual page). How to Implement Interval with Loading Text? We can also use jQuery.each function if you dont want to use the for loop. . The